Easy Gingerbread Waffles

Description

Delicious gingerbread waffles infused with warm spices and a hint of sweetness from molasses, perfect for any breakfast table.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 cups mil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 1/2 cup molasses
  • 1/4 cup vegetable oil

Instructions

  1. Preheat your waffle iron according to the manufacturer’s instructions.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, ginger,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
  3. In another bowl, combine the milk, egg, molasses, and vegetable oil. Whisk until smooth.
  4.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ir gently until just combined.
  5. Grease your waffle iron if necessary, and pour about 1/2 cup of batter into the preheated waffle iron.
  6. Cook until the waffles are golden brown and crisp, then serve warm with your choice of toppings.

Notes

Serve with maple syrup, whipped cream, or fresh fruit.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days, or freeze for longer storage.
